What makes a shoe good for bowling?

A good pair of bowling shoes need to be comfortable, supportive and provide you with balance and stability. You need to consider the fit around your toes, ankle, and heel support as well as the arch of your foot. Of course, you also want a pair of shoes that will last at least one or two seasons.

Are bowling shoes really necessary?

Your normal sneakers will stick to the lane and cause you to stop abruptly, preventing you from making the correct sliding motion. Also, they prevent you from getting hurt because you move better and stop safely with them on. Beyond staying safe, bowling shoes also protect the lanes.

Is it worth it to buy bowling shoes?

Rented bowling shoes are worn by hundreds of people, and while they are sanitized between bowlers, that alone is enough reason for some folks to prefer their own pair. However, buying your own bowling shoes also means that you can get a better fit, higher quality, and more comfort, which can impact how well you bowl.

Why can’t bowling alleys wear regular shoes?

Damage to the Approach – The wearing of ‘street shoes’ on the bowling approach can cause damage, scuffing or marking the floor and you could also bring in dirt and moisture from outside.

Should you tuck your pinky while bowling?

By tucking your bowling pinky finger where the first knuckle joint on your smallest finger (pinky finger) and your fingernail lies on the surface of the bowling ball, your thumb will exit the ball quickly and your bowling fingers will become more active when turning and applying releasing action onto the bowling ball.

What is the 3 6 9 rule in bowling?

This system was developed many years ago, and it involves moving your feet right either three, six, or nine boards from the spot you stood to shoot your strike depending upon the front pin in the row you’re trying to convert. By moving your feet that way, you can easily convert most of the spares.
